Transaction a353777d178fab5e62db8b2c70d3844179f9661718943149007e2aa5fde09bc1

16 Input
2 Outputs
  • a353777d178fab5e62db8b2c70d3844179f9661718943149007e2aa5fde09bc1:0
  • value  994305
    address  32HrRgyYADQTYhvJ9GsXWZKeKp3RZ9bKPz
  • a353777d178fab5e62db8b2c70d3844179f9661718943149007e2aa5fde09bc1:1
  • value  125355690
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s